Queens Car Accident: What Should You Do Before Talking to an Insurance Company?

After a car accident in Queens, many people panic and call the insurance company right away. But what you say during those first calls can affect your claim, your compensation, and even how fault is viewed. New York sees more than 100,000 motor vehicle crashes each year, and many lead to difficult insurance disputes. Why You Should Be Cautious When Speaking to Insurance Companies

Insurance companies do not work for you, even if it is your own insurer. Their main goal is to limit payouts and protect profits. Anything you say—even a simple apology—can hurt your insurance claim. The Insurance Company’s Goal After a Car Accident

After a car crash, insurance adjusters act fast. They want to settle the claim quickly and cheaply, often before you know the full extent of your injuries. A recorded statement can be used to question your pain later or dispute your medical bills. Adjusters may act friendly, but they are trained to reduce your payment. Common Tactics Used by Insurance Adjusters

Insurance adjusters often use tactics that make victims feel rushed or confused. These may include:

  • Pressuring you to give a recorded statement immediately
  • Downplaying injuries or dismissing symptoms
  • Asking misleading questions about fault or speed
  • Suggesting you don’t need a personal injury attorney
  • Offering a low settlement before medical care is complete

Steps to Take Before Talking to the Insurance Company

Steps to Take Before Talking to the Insurance Company

Before you contact any insurer, take steps to protect your health and your legal rights. Careful preparation ensures accurate information and prevents mistakes.

Gather Evidence at the Accident Scene

Right after the accident, collect as much evidence as possible. Take photos of the scene, road conditions,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ries. Get witness statements, contact information, and license plate numbers of all drivers. Call the police and request a police report, which will serve as key evidence under New York vehicle and traffic laws. These details help strengthen your claim and support your version of events.

Seek Medical Treatment Immediately

Always seek medical treatment after a crash, even if you feel fine. Many injuries—such as traumatic brain injuries, soft tissue damage, or internal harm—do not show symptoms right away. Keep copies of all medical records, doctor notes, and medical expenses. Quick care helps your health and proves the injuries came from the auto accident. Under New York’s no-fault insurance system, early treatment also supports your PIP coverage.

What You Should Avoid Saying to an Insurance Company

Before speaking with an insurance company, you should understand that even simple comments can harm your claim. Adjusters look for statements they can use to limit damages or shift liability. Don’t Admit Fault or Speculate

Never guess how the motor vehicle accident happened or accept blame. Evidence, photographs, witness statements, and accident reconstruction specialists determine fault in motor vehicle collisions. Crashes in New York City, Long Island, or Queens can involve distracted driving, speeding, or reckless driving by multiple people. Only trained investigators decide who is responsible. Don’t Discuss Your Injuries Too Early

Many victims feel pressured to talk about injuries right away, but early statements can be wrong. Some injuries—like soft tissue damage or internal trauma—appear days after a crash. If you describe your injuries too soon, the insurer may deny later problems and limit economic damages or pain and suffering. Avoid signing a medical release until you get legal advice. Understanding Your Legal Rights After a Queens Car Accident

Understanding Your Legal Rights After a Queens Car Accident

New York follows no-fault car insurance laws, which affect what you can recover and when you can file a lawsuit. After an accident, your own insurance usually pays medical bills under personal injury protection. This system helps victims get fast coverage, but it also limits the kinds of claims they can file. What No-Fault Insurance Covers

Under New York’s no-fault rules, PIP coverage provides benefits such as:

  • Medical care and treatment costs
  • A portion of lost wages
  • Replacement of essential household services
  • Transportation to medical visits

These benefits help with recovery but do not cover full damages, such as long-term pain or emotional harm. That is why some cases qualify for lawsuits outside the no-fault system.

When You Can Step Outside the No-Fault System

Victims may sue when they suffer “serious injuries,” such as:

  • Fractures or permanent disability
  • Significant scarring or disfigurement
  • Long-term loss of a bodily function
  • Severe limits that impact daily life

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Should I speak to the insurance company right after the accident?

It’s best to wait. Anything you say can create liability issues, especially before the facts are clear. Speak with us first so we can guide you and protect your rights.

Can I handle an insurance claim without a lawyer?

You can, but it’s risky. Insurance adjusters know how to use your words, pictures, or even social media posts against you. Our legal team helps you avoid mistakes and strengthens your claim.

What if the insurance adjuster pressures me to settle?

You do not have to agree. Early settlements often ignore long-term medical needs and future costs. We step in to stop pressure tactics and negotiate a fair outcome.

How long do I have to file a claim in New York?

Most car accident cases must follow strict deadlines, including Notice of Claim rules for public agencies. Waiting too long may block your right to recover damages. We help clients file everything on time.

What damages can I recover after a car accident?

You may recover medical costs, lost income, property damage, and pain and suffering. Under comparative negligence, even partially at-fault victims may recover reduced damages. We help calculate the full amount.
